  5. Incorrect, in particular because you are limiting your comment to WRs. Kincaid gets down the field. Cook gets down the field (even though he drops it). Coleman's TD was down the field. The Bills' passing game is clearly designed to give Josh some "easy answers" without waiting for deep routes to develop. KC runs the same damn thing! Are they limiting their strength at QB too? The modern NFL demands quick plays...the Bills are adapting to that, not fighting against it. I'll take 75+% Josh with a 7-0 TD/INT ratio, making some "Superman" plays here and there when he has to, every day of the week and twice on Sunday. I watched the Giants/Cowboys game last night, and saw Jones force feed "true WR1" Nabers the ball 11 or 12 times for over 100 yards. The Giants still didn't score a TD and lost a game in which they held Dallas to 20 points. Sometimes I think many of you are just rooting for your fantasy football stats...
